码迷,mamicode.com
首页 > 2015年07月28日 > 全部分享
优化分析模型
优化分析模型应该关注以下几点: 1、容易变化的需求 容易变化的需求需要给予关注。如果一个需求在调研时就发现它很不稳定,那么客户说不清楚,要么客户承认他们还在调整,或者客户的各个单位之间并不统一,这时就应当考虑优化分析模型,让其带有一定的可扩展的能力。例如采用一些设计模式来避免硬编码业务逻辑。 2、结构化和耦合度的调整 不好的结构是网状结构,对象之间相互依赖。这样的结构耦合度高,扩展能力和适...
分类:其他好文   时间:2015-07-28 23:11:35    阅读次数:136
通过“分布式系统的8大谬误”反思APP的设计 第六篇 谬误6:只有一个管理者
我们再回顾一下著名的分布式系统的8大谬论,以及如何在开发应用是避免这些问题。1,网络是可靠的;2,网络不存在时延;3,网络带宽是无限的;4,网络是安全的;5,网络拓扑结构是不会变化的;6,只有一个管理员;7,网络传输是不需要任何代价;8,网络是同构的。谬误6:只有一个管理者。作为一个开发者,你可以控制在什么时候发布新的APP或新的服务器版本,但任何人都控制不了到底有多少类型的设备在运行你的APP。用...
分类:移动开发   时间:2015-07-28 23:09:06    阅读次数:130
Different Ways to Add Parentheses
Given a string of numbers and operators, return all possible results from computing all the different possible ways to group numbers and operators. The valid operators are+, - and *. Example 1 I...
分类:其他好文   时间:2015-07-28 23:10:46    阅读次数:155
pandas 学习笔记
读者只需浏览一下本文的目录结构,我相信就已经掌握了1到2成的 pandas 知识。本文的目的是建立一个大概的知识结构在数据挖掘python阅读源码时,断断续续查阅了些 pandas 资料,并在源码中大致感受到了 pandas 在数据清理方面的方便性。先将自己查阅的资料结合实际应用中常用到的方式,以学习笔记的形式整理出来。不会涉及到 pandas 的所有方面,细节知识还需自行查阅官方文档。数据结构 S...
分类:其他好文   时间:2015-07-28 23:10:56    阅读次数:168
sonarQube自动化测试之sonar-runner进行测试
在网上看了许多sonarQube的教程,首先这里向大家说明下两者的关系 sonarQube是一个(代码质量管理平台)开源平台,用于管理Java源代码的质量,通俗点说个人认为其实类似于一个服务器,就像Tomcat或者是JBOSS一样. 用服务器这个空架子肯定不能进行检测代码,而sonar-runner相当于是在这个平台下测试的一个扫描代码的工具,两者配合着使用才能进行通用的自动化测试(适合任意工...
分类:其他好文   时间:2015-07-28 23:08:13    阅读次数:9742
C++ Primer 学习笔记_19_类与数据抽象(5)_初始化列表(const和引用成员)、拷贝构造函数
C++ Primer 学习笔记_19_类与数据抽象(5)_初始化列表(const和引用成员)、拷贝构造函数  从概念上将,可以认为构造函数分为两个阶段执行:     1)初始化阶段;     2)普通的计算阶段。计算阶段由构造函数函数体中的所有语句组成。 一、构造函数初始化列表 推荐在构造函数初始化列表中进行初始化 1、对象成员及...
分类:编程语言   时间:2015-07-28 23:09:01    阅读次数:166
Subsets II
Given a collection of integers that might contain duplicates, nums, return all possible subsets. Note: Elements in a subset must be in non-descending order.The solution set must not contain du...
分类:其他好文   时间:2015-07-28 23:09:23    阅读次数:131
mac的shell神插件zsh
自从用了mac之后就各种配置,本文的前提是使用tmux的朋友,介绍一款神插件zsh,先说一下为什么要用它: Crtl + z挂起进程的时候会显示进程的pid,这样当手动Crtl +c 终止程序失败的时候可以用kill + pid来杀死进程;用Git时打开项目可以显示当前所在的分支;使用任何命令时都可以进行补全操作,很方便;可以安装扩展插件,功能可以不断扩展; 安装,直接用命令:...
分类:系统相关   时间:2015-07-28 23:09:56    阅读次数:189
hdu 5289(二分+RMQ) Assignment
题意:给一个序列,然后求出连续的序列中最大和最小值之差小于k的。思路二分+ST 二分下标,然后找一个最大的区间满足区间内最大最小值相差小于k,当前这个位置对于答案的贡献就是这个区间长度。 求一个静态数组的区间最大最小值,用ST算法就好了。参考code:/* #pragma warning (disable: 4786) #pragma comment (linker, "/STACK:0x8...
分类:其他好文   时间:2015-07-28 23:09:14    阅读次数:131
php的curl抓包
在PHP中实现抓包有两种方式,一个是使用file_get_contents()函数采集页面内容,另一种就是curlCURL请求过程 curl完成请求主要是分为以下四步: 1、初始化,创建一个新的curl资源(即:curl_init()) 2、设置URL和相应的选项(即:curl_setopt() ) 3、抓取URL并把它传递给浏览器(即...
分类:Web程序   时间:2015-07-28 23:09:42    阅读次数:212
HDU 5317 RGCDQ (素因子分解+预处理)
HDU 5317 RGCDQ (素因子分解+预处理)...
分类:其他好文   时间:2015-07-28 23:09:21    阅读次数:156
应用间的跳转
应用间的跳转标签(空格分隔): ios进阶在手机app中经常需要在应用间跳转,比如微信分享,支付宝付款,第三方登陆等。简单的例子这些都是很常见的应用,要实现这样的功能需要在应用程序中设置 URL Schemes(目标应用程序)然后在程序中写如下代码就可以跳转了- (IBAction)weixing { NSURL *url = [NSURL URLWithString:@"weixin:/...
分类:其他好文   时间:2015-07-28 23:07:49    阅读次数:255
35 - 找出字符串中第一个只出现一次的字符
在一个字符串中找到第一个只出现一次的字符。 如输入”abaccdeff”,输出’b’解析: 使用一个数组,记录每个字符出现的次数,最后遍历计数数组,第一个个数为 1 的即为结果。 由于字符char,只有8 bit, 只有255种可能,因此只需声明一个255大小的数组。遍历一次字符串,遍历2次计数数组:时间复杂度O(n) 空间占用255*int = 512 Byte,是一个固定大小:空间复杂度...
分类:其他好文   时间:2015-07-28 23:06:50    阅读次数:129
MPChartAndroid使用讲解
最的项目里又要加更加复杂的图表了,实在是不想在去自己实现了,就想找个第三方的开源图表库去实现,以前自己封装过achartenginee这个apache的图表引擎,但看到这个MPChartAndroid后,觉得 achartengine简直是弱爆了。下面就先对比一下MPChartEnginee的优势,及其使用。   MPChartEnginee的优点:1.更加美观的外表,从官方给的各自的两个Dem...
分类:移动开发   时间:2015-07-28 23:09:21    阅读次数:1142
提高代码性能效率总结(二)--Java
继续进行代码优化的总结. 7.循环优化 List alist =getList(); for(int i=0;i 代码会一直执行alist.size()  应修改为 for(int i=0,p=alist.size();i 8."消灭"不可视阶段的对象 try{ Object obj=new Object(); }catch(Exception e) { obj=null;...
分类:编程语言   时间:2015-07-28 23:08:48    阅读次数:129
Oracle 第2节 过滤和排序数据
LessonAim While retrieving data from the database, you may need to restrict the rows of data that are displayed or specify the order in which the rows are displayed.  This lesson explains the SQ...
分类:数据库   时间:2015-07-28 23:08:17    阅读次数:203
泛型+多态
泛型的基础是多态...
分类:其他好文   时间:2015-07-28 23:06:38    阅读次数:110
2510条   上一页 1 2 3 4 5 6 7 8 ... 148 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!